Shiv Sena MP Sanjay Raut has announced that Shiv Sena will contest 50 to 100 seats in Uttar Pradesh, including that seat in Ayodhya, after a closed-door meeting with Bharatiya Kisan Union national spokesperson Chaudhary Rakesh Tikait. Due to which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ath is going to contest the elections. The meeting of both of them lasted for about an hour at the residence of Chaudhary Rakesh Tikait in Muzaffarnagar. During this, Sanjay Rawat got Rakesh Tikait’s conversation with Shiv Sena President and Maharashtra Chief Minister Uddhav Thackeray over the phone. Responding to what happened during this, Shiv Sena MP Sanjay Raut said that he had come here today with a special purpose and he would not disclose what happened in the closed room between the party president and Rakesh Tikait, the voice of farmers.

He said that – today he had come to express his gratitude to Rakesh Tikait for fighting the long battle of farmers and to invite him to talk to party president Uddhav Thackeray on the issue related to farmers in Maharashtra. He said that – Shri Tikait’s family has also been related to Shivaji Maharaj’s family, so this meeting was special, he also showed some papers which included a letter written by Shivaji family to Tikait family. Shri Rawat said that Rakesh Tikait is now a big face of farmers and he should get an opportunity to raise voice of farmers of India in United Nations Organization. At the same time, he said that Rakesh Tikait may be political, but he must elect 8-10 representatives and send them to the Parliament. Mr. Rawat said that soon Shiv Sena will release its manifesto. On the question of who he wants to see as the Chief Minister of Uttar Pradesh, he said that wait now. In the press conference, on the question of what is meant by the saffron cloth around the neck of both Rawat and Rakesh Tikait, both said that the saffron color is the identity of the social and the nation…. Do not look from the political point of view.
